E BUILT-IN TRANSISTOR SWITCHING REGULATOR Rev.3.2_00 The S-8353/8354 Series is a CMOS step-up switching regulator which mainly consists of a reference voltage source, an oscillation circuit, a power MOS FET, an error amplifier, a phase compensation circuit, a PWM control circuit (S-8353 Series) and a PWM / PFM switching control circuit (S-8354 Series). The S-8353/8354 Series can configure the step-up switching regulator with an external coil, capacitor, and diode.
